The collection ends with Rick’s son, Carl, shooting Shane to save his father (a major plot departure point for the TV series where Shane is still alive and well). Shane and Rick go hunting and Shane pulls a gun on Rick and tries to kill him. After constantly pushing Shane and the others to move the camp to a safer distance from Atlanta, Shane and Rick’s problems come to a head (though Rick never learned about Shane’s tryst with his wife) after zombies invade the camp (which has a host of other members) and kill two of the survivors. There is trouble in paradise however as Rick’s wife Lori has slept with Rick’s best friend Shane because she thought that Rick had died in the hospital bed. With the help of an Asian twenty-something named Glen, Rick is able to make it out of Atlanta and back to Glen’s camp where he finds his wife, his son, and his best friend from the force. After learning that Atlanta is the most likely location of his wife and son, Rick heads off to Atlanta only to discover that the city isn’t a safe-have but is has been completely taken over by the zombies. Rick quickly discovers that the hospital (and the whole world) are over-run by zombies that want nothing more than to eat his flesh. ![]() He wakes up an undisclosed amount of time later in a hospital and finds himself in a world that has literally gone to hell. 1, Days Gone Bye, we are introduced to Rick Grimes, a Kentucky police officer who is shot during a stand-off along the highway. This article is completely compatible with 1.16.X. ![]() For example, when equal parts of red and yellow paint are mixed together, the resulting color is orange. ![]() The secondary colors result from mixing the primaries in different proportions. These six colors are the basis of all other hues. The three secondary colors are green, orange, and purple. In painting, the three primary colors are red, yellow, and blue. The term “tertiary” is sometimes used to describe any color that is made by mixing two other colors together, regardless of whether those colors are primary or secondary. Tertiary colors can be made in two ways: by mixing two different secondary colors together (e.g., green and violet to make blue-violet), or by adding equal parts of a primary color and a secondary color that lies on either side of it on the color wheel (e.g., adding yellow and green to make yellow-green). There are six tertiary colors: red-orange, yellow-orange, yellow-green, blue-green, blue-violet, and red-violet. For example, red-orange is made by mixing red and orange together. Tertiary colors are made by mixing a primary and a secondary color together. Other combinations include red and blue (purple) or red and yellow (orange). The most common combination is yellow and blue, which makes green. The secondary colors are those that are made by mixing two primary colors together.
